Volume for the Top 50 ACH Banks And Credit Unions Increases 5.7% in 2023
The top 50 originating financial institutions on the automated clearing house network hit nearly 27.7 billion in payments in 2023, a 5.7% increase over 2022, Nacha says. New Nacha Rules Take Aim At Credit Push Fraud, Handing a Clearer Role to Receivers
Nacha, the governing body for the automated clearing house network, has approved a new set of rules aimed at curbing the growing threat of credit-push fraud. TCH’s ACH Volume up 8% And Other Digital Transactions News briefs from 3/12/24
The Clearing House Payments Co. LLC’s automated clearing house network, EPN, reported volume of more than 19 billion transactions for 2023, up 8%, with a total value of $52.4 trillion.
